Overview of Amsterdam Small-Group Walking Tour

During the Amsterdam Small-Group Walking Tour, participants have the opportunity to explore the highlights of Amsterdam and explore the city’s rich history and culture.
This 3-hour tour, led by an expert local guide, takes you to some of the most iconic sites in the city. You’ll visit Dam Square and the Royal Palace, where you can learn about the city’s historical significance.
The tour also includes a visit to the famous Red Light District, where you can experience Amsterdam’s unique culture and atmosphere. You’ll have the chance to see the Anne Frank House, stroll along the picturesque canals, and explore the charming Jordaan neighborhood.
Plus, the tour offers cultural experiences such as visiting the Van Gogh Museum and the Rijksmuseum, where you can admire Dutch masterpieces. You’ll also have the opportunity to experience the vibrant Albert Cuyp Market and enjoy a traditional Dutch snack at a local cafe.

Common Questions

What Is the Maximum Number of Participants Allowed on the Amsterdam Small-Group Walking Tour?
The Amsterdam Small-Group Walking Tour allows a maximum number of 12 participants. This intimate group size ensures a personalized experience, allowing participants to fully enjoy the history and culture of the city.
Can Children Participate in the Tour? Is There an Age Restriction?
Children of all ages are welcome to participate in the tour. There is no specific age restriction, allowing families to enjoy the experience together and learn about the history and culture of Amsterdam.
Are There Any Additional Fees or Costs Not Mentioned in the Pricing Section?
There are no additional fees or hidden costs mentioned in the pricing section of the Amsterdam Small-Group Walking Tour. The price of £19.57 covers the experience, and there are no extra charges to worry about.
Is Transportation Included in the Tour or Do Participants Need to Arrange Their Own?
Transportation arrangements are not included in the tour, so you will need to arrange their own. The tour duration is 3 hours, during which you will explore the highlights of Amsterdam on foot.
Are There Any Specific Clothing or Dress Code Requirements for the Tour?
There are no specific clothing requirements or dress code for the tour. However, participants are advised to consider the weather conditions and wear comfortable walking shoes.
